What Does CADL Do?

Candel Therapeutics, Inc., founded in 2003 and headquartered in Needham, Massachusetts, is a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company dedicated to developing immunotherapies for cancer patients. Originally known as Advantagene, Inc., the company rebranded in November 2020 to reflect its focus on innovative therapeutic solutions. Candel's lead product candidate, CAN-2409, is currently undergoing Phase II clinical trials for pancreatic cancer, Phase III trials for prostate cancer, and Phase II trials for lung cancer. Additionally, CAN-2409 has completed Phase Ib/II trials for high-grade glioma, showcasing its potential across multiple cancer types. The company is also advancing CAN-3110, which is in Phase I trials for recurrent glioblastoma. With a small but dedicated team of 38 employees, Candel Therapeutics aims to leverage its expertise in immunotherapy to address significant unmet needs in oncology, positioning itself as a forward-thinking entity in the biopharmaceutical landscape.

Key Financial Metrics

Return on equity for Candel Therapeutics, Inc. stands at -60.4%, a gauge of how efficiently it converts shareholder capital into profit. Return on assets is -27.0%, showing how much profit it generates from its asset base. Its free cash flow yield is -8.7%, a gauge of the cash the business throws off relative to its market value. A current ratio of 28.05 indicates the company holds enough short-term assets to cover its near-term obligations. Its earnings yield is -8.5%, the inverse of the P/E and a quick read on earnings relative to price.

F-Score 2/9

Financial Health

Candel Therapeutics, Inc.'s Piotroski F-Score is 2/9, a 9-point checklist of profitability, leverage and efficiency — flagging fundamental weakness worth scrutiny. Its Altman Z-Score of 4.43 places it in the safe zone, indicating low near-term bankruptcy risk.
